Prince Harry and Meghan Markle will be bringing more film and TV content to Netflix subscribers.
On Monday, Aug. 11, the streaming giant and the couple’s media company, Archewell Productions, announced they’ve signed a new multiyear, first-look deal covering all of Harry and Meghan’s film and television projects.
A first-look deal is an agreement that gives said studio the rights to review and potentially acquire new projects. If the studio doesn’t want to buy the concept, the production company can shop it to others.
Per Netflix, the extended agreement includes season 2 of With Love, Meghan; a special holiday episode of the lifestyle and cooking show; a feature film titled Meet Me at the Lake; a documentary short on Uganda’s Masaka region; and new As Ever products.
“We’re proud to extend our partnership with Netflix and expand our work together to include the As ever brand,” Meghan said in a statement.
“My husband and I feel inspired by our partners who work closely with us and our Archewell Productions team to create thoughtful content across genres that resonates globally, and celebrates our shared vision,” she added.

Netflix began its partnership with Archewell in 2020. To date, the production banner has released the docuseries Polo; as well as With Love, Meghan; Heart of Invictus; Harry & Meghan and Live to Lead. Meghan, the Duchess of Sussex and Netflix have also partnered on her lifestyle brand, As ever.
“Harry and Meghan are influential voices whose stories resonate with audiences everywhere,” said Bela Bajaria, Netflix’s chief content officer. “We’re excited to continue our partnership with Archewell Productions and to entertain our members together.”
While the docuseries Polo had limited appeal, Harry & Meghan was a big hit. According to Netflix, it’s been viewed 23.4 million times, making it the platform’s fifth most popular docuseries of all time.
Meanwhile, the cooking and lifestyle show With Love, Meghan reached the streamer’s Top 10 lists in 24 countries. The series has so far garnered 5.3 million views.

Meet Me at the Lake
A romance feature film adaptation of the bestselling novel of the same name from Canadian writer and journalist Carley Fortune.
Masaka Kids, A Rhythm Within
A new documentary short from Campfire Studios in Association with Wontanara Productions and Archewell.
In the heart of Uganda’s Masaka region, where the shadows of the HIV/AIDS crisis linger, a small orphanage becomes a beacon of hope. The documentary goes beyond the viral videos to reveal a vibrant, one-of-a-kind community where orphaned children transform hardship into joy, dancing their way toward healing, belonging, and the promise of a brighter future. Directors are David Vieira Lopez and Moses Bwayo.
